Преобразование XLSX в CSV с отсутствующими столбцами ImportExcel в Powershell - PullRequest
0 голосов
/ 13 марта 2020

Я конвертирую файлы с модулем Import-Excel в Powershell с помощью этого простого кода:

Import-Excel -Path $PSScriptRoot\*.xlsx | Export-Csv $PSScriptRoot\file.csv -NoTypeInformation

Проблема в том, что в этом файле есть только два столбца с данными:

Articleno и Quantity

Когда количество равно 0 (ноль) в первой строке, модуль просто экспортирует первый столбец в csv; столбец Quantity полностью игнорируется.

Что я делаю не так? Почему Import-Excel также не экспортирует 0?

1 Ответ

0 голосов
/ 15 марта 2020

ок Проблема в том, что «ImportExcel» всегда ожидает заголовок в первой строке. При использовании тега «-NoHeader» все работает нормально, и 0 в первой строке будет импортирован.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...